**Seller can assist with Closing Costs AND will provide a one year Home Warranty with American Home Shield.** Luxurious like affordable condo that's centrally located behind North Star Mall in the desirable Ridgeview/Shearer Hills area AND includes all appliances. This beautiful second floor Condo was updated in 2024 with a new roof, new floors, new kitchen countertops, new dishwasher, new bathtub, new shower tile, new vanity, new toilet, new washer & dryer and has fresh paint throughout. It is located across the street from an elementary school and is in a gated community that's pet-friendly. Monthly HOA dues cover water, trash, landscaping and include two assigned parking spaces. The Quarry, Alamo Heights, Downtown & Multiple Universities are just a short drive away. Lots of dining and entertainment options such as the Movie Theatre, Bowling Alley and Comedy Club are just a short walk away!

Demographic facts
for San Antonio, TX 78216

San Antonio, TX 78216 has a population of 39,847 people in 18,254 households with a median age of 35.7 years old.
